| Description | Anti-inflammatory agent 40 is a promising, orally-active compound with anti-malarial and anti-inflammatory properties that effectively inhibits carrageenan-induced paw swelling in vivo. |
| In vitro | Anti-inflammatory agent 40 (compound 5p) exhibits inhibitory effects on chloroquine-sensitive and resistant strains of Plasmodium falciparum, with an IC50 of 1.47 μM against the chloroquine-sensitive strain (Pf 3D7). It also suppresses lipopolysaccharide-induced activation of MAP kinases and reduces the expression of phosphorylated ERK1/2 (Thr202/Tyr204) and JNK1/2 in THP-1 monocytes [1]. |
| In vivo | Anti-inflammatory agent 40 (compound 5p) showed inhibition of carrageenan-induced paw swelling in Swiss mice when administered 1 hour before carrageenan injection at 25, 50, and 100 mg/kg, with swelling reductions observed at 4 and 6 hours post-injection. At 25 mg/kg, inhibition rates were 61% and 56% at 4 and 6 hours, respectively; at 50 mg/kg, rates were 73% and 65%. Agent 40 also had favorable pharmacokinetics, with a Cmax of 110.37±11.92 ng/mL, Tmax of 0.25±0.0 h, AUC of 86.91±16.86 h.ng/mL, and T1/2 of 0.87±0.15 h, making it a promising candidate for future drug discovery optimization [1]. |
| Molecular Weight | 547.43 |
| Formula | C30H24Cl2N2O4 |
| Storage | Powder: -20°C for 3 years | In solvent: -80°C for 1 year | Shipping with blue ice/Shipping at ambient temperature. |
